Wedding Inspiration | Eucalyptus

I love seeing floral inspiration boards so after this last wedding, I felt INSPIRED! Who knew you could create a whole wedding style using mixed eucalyptus?


The featured wedding used this trendy (and amazing smelling) greenery for their rehearsal dinner, ceremony, and reception. Their centerpieces consisted of seeded, baby, and silver dollar eucalyptus mixed with white roses, delphinium stems and hydrangeas.

Although you can match almost any color with eucalyptus greenery, this wedding included dark wood and burgundy accents. They used gold and olive green cloth napkins from A1 Rentals and their cake topper was a custom made wooden logo.


Eucalyptus as wedding decor has actually been around for a while. We used it back in for our Fall Wedding Show Booth to decorate our Blue Diamond Events sign.

Kent's Floral Gallery did this adorable seeded eucalyptus garland for us, and we paired it with navy blue and gold accents.

It's drapy texture makes it the perfect compliment to any welcome sign or seating chart.
